The Floor Repair Process in Fair Lawn
When you engage a local Fair Lawn floor repair professional, the process typically begins with a thorough inspection of the damaged area. This initial assessment allows experts to accurately diagnose the problem, determine the extent of the damage, and recommend the most effective repair solution.
Following the inspection, the repair process will vary depending on the flooring material. For wood floors, this might involve sanding down scratches, filling in gouges, or replacing individual damaged boards. In cases of significant water damage, professionals will ensure the subfloor is dry before installing new wood. For carpet, repairs could include patching small holes, re-seaming splits, or performing a full stretching and reinstallation if necessary. Tile and grout repairs involve removing damaged tiles and grout, cleaning the area, and then carefully replacing them with new materials, ensuring a seamless match.

Frequently Asked Questions about Floor Repair in Fair Lawn
How much does floor repair typically cost in Fair Lawn?
The cost of floor repair in Fair Lawn can vary significantly based on the type of flooring, the extent of the damage, and the complexity of the repair. Simple repairs like filling small scratches on hardwood or patching a small section of carpet might cost a few hundred dollars, while more extensive repairs, such as replacing multiple water-damaged wood planks or re-tiling a large bathroom floor, could range into the thousands. For an accurate estimate tailored to your specific needs, it is best to get a quote from a local professional.
What are the signs that my floors in Fair Lawn might need immediate repair?
Several signs indicate that your floors might require immediate attention. These include visible cracks or holes in tiles or wood, loose or squeaky floorboards, sections of flooring that are peeling or lifting, significant warping or buckling, and persistent musty odors which can indicate underlying moisture issues, especially common in proximity to the Hackensack River. Ignoring these signs can lead to more extensive damage and costly repairs.
